How much do North Eastern Hill University (NEHU) Bangalore employees make?
Employees who graduate from North Eastern Hill University (NEHU) in Bangalore earn an average of ₹20.8lakhs, mostly ranging from ₹15.9lakhs per year to ₹47.5lakhs per year based on 52 profiles. The top 10% of employees earn more than ₹32.1lakhs per year.
What is the average salary of North Eastern Hill University (NEHU) Bangalore?
Average salary of an employee who graduate from North Eastern Hill University (NEHU) in Bangalore is ₹20.8lakhs.
What is the highest salary offered who graduate from North Eastern Hill University (NEHU) in Bangalore?
Highest reported salary offered who graduate from North Eastern Hill University (NEHU) in Bangalore is ₹50.0lakhs. The top 10% of employees earn more than ₹32.1lakhs per year. The top 1% earn more than a whopping ₹47.5lakhs per year.
What are the most common skills required who graduate from North Eastern Hill University (NEHU) in Bangalore?
19% of employees have skills in project management . 17% also know business development . 12% also know service delivery .
What are the highest paying jobs who graduate from North Eastern Hill University (NEHU) in Bangalore?
The top 5 highest paying jobs who graduate from North Eastern Hill University (NEHU) in Bangalore with reported salaries are:
director - ₹45.0lakhs per year
project manager - ₹20.0lakhs per year
operations manager - ₹13.0lakhs per year
manager - ₹10.0lakhs per year
What is the median salary offered who graduate from North Eastern Hill University (NEHU) in Bangalore?
The median salary approximately calculated from salary profiles measured so far is ₹17.1lakhs per year.
How is the age distributed among employees who graduate from North Eastern Hill University (NEHU) in Bangalore?
This group has a predominantly younger workforce. 46% of employees lie between 31-36 yrs . 25% of the employees fall in the age group of 36-41 yrs .
What qualifications do employees have who graduate from North Eastern Hill University (NEHU) in Bangalore?
65% of employees have a PostGraduate degree. 17% hold a Graduate degree.
Which schools do employees working who graduate from North Eastern Hill University (NEHU) in Bangalore went to?
96% of employees studied at North Eastern Hill University (NEHU) . 10% studied at Sikkim Manipal University (SMU) .
